The Wonder by Patriot Ordnance Factory (POF) is a lightweight carbine that combine utility and luxury. This AR platform carbine comes packed with features including POF’s patented heat sink barrel nut to reduce the heat generated when firing, a roller cam pin with direct impingement bolt carrier group, POF’s own Strike Eagle ambidextrous charging handle a single stage match grade trigger, and the new Micro B single port muzzle brake.
